有限元方法B实验报告与作业班级:411210班姓名:林亮基学号:41121010学院:机械学院吉林大学机械科学与工程学院41121010林亮基目录实验1:杆系结构有限元静力学分析.....................................................1实验2:基于APDL命令流方式的杆系结构有限元静力学分析.....4实验3:实体建模.....................................................................................6实验4:平面结构有限元静力学分析.....................................................9实验5:平面结构有限元静力学分析...................................................14实验6:空间结构有限元静力学分析..................................................18作业1杆系结构有限元分析.................................................................20作业2平面问题有限元分析.................................................................22作业3空间问题有限元分析.................................................................24吉林大学机械科学与工程学院41121010林亮基第1页实验1:杆系结构有限元静力学分析一、实验目的:通过本实验掌握杆系结构有限元静力学分析GUI操作,并熟悉相应的APDL命令流。二、问题描述:上图所示为订书钉,尺寸见图中标注。材料弹性模量为E=2.1×105MPa,泊松比为0.3,横截面积尺寸为宽B=0.64mm,高H=0.402mm。当订书钉被压入纸张时,约需要120N的载荷,载荷均匀分布在订书钉上部。就以下两种情况进行有限元分析:1)钉入时A、B为铰支;2)钉入时A、B为固支。三、实验思路:1)由于结构和谁都处于平面内,且结构和受力相对于订书钉中心轴对称,所以可采用对称的平面梁模型,即选取1/2模型进行分析,在此考虑了在梁模型中的倒角对结构变形和受力的情况影响;2)单元类型选择BEAM188;(在ANSYS14.0里只能选这个了)3)根据坐标生成关键点,由关键点连成线,生成直线倒角,再对几何模型(线)进行(一维)网格划分。四、实验步骤:1、选择单元类型在ANSYS界面内,执行MainMenuPreprocessorElementTypeAdd/Edit/Delete,添加一个element;选择StructuralBeam2node188,点击OK确定。2、定义截面属性SectionsBeamCommonSections在弹出的对话框中输入截面尺寸(B=0.402,H=0.64)此处一度遇到困难,因为14.0版本中的Beam188无需定义实常数。3、定义材料参数在ANSYS界面中执行MainMenuPreprocessorMaterialPropsMaterialModelsStructuralLinearElasticIsotropic在这里必须指出的是,指导书上全都说明要双击打开,实际上是单击即可。4、生成几何模型Step1生成三个关键点MainMenuPreprocessorModelingCreateKeypointsInActiveCS依次输入三个点的坐标:(6.32,0,0)、(6.32,6.1,0)、(0,6.1,0),每输入一个点的坐标后点Apply,输入最后一个坐标点Apply后点Cancel。Step2生成两条线段MainMenuPreprocessorModelingCreatelineslinesInActiveCoord吉林大学机械科学与工程学院41121010林亮基第2页分别用Pick选择点1和2,再选择点2和点3,点击OKStep3建立线1和线2之间的倒角MainMenuPreprocessorModelingCreatelineslineFilletPick分别单击线1和线2OKFilletradius中输入0.5,在Numbertoassign中输入6,点击OK5、划分单元Step1设置所有的线上划分单元的个数MainMenuPreprocessorMeshingSizeCntrlsManualSizelinesAlllines在No.ofelementdivisions中输入4,点击OK。Step2划分单元MainMenuPreprocessorMeshingMeshlines点击Pickall,点击OK6、施加约束和均布力Step1施加均布力UtilityMenuSelectEntitieslinesByLocationYcoordinates输入6.1,点击OKUtilityMenuSelectEntitiesElementsAttachedtolines点击OKMainmenuSolutionDefineLoadsApplyStructuralPressureOnBeams点击Pickall,输入-120/(6.32-0.5)/2,点击OKStep2对关键点3施加X方向约束和相对于Z方向的旋转约束UtilityMenuSelectEverythingPreprocessorLoadsDefineLoadsApplyStructuralDisplacementOnKeypoints选择关键点3,选择UX和ROTZ,点击OKStep3对关键点1施加固定边界条件PreprocessorLoadsDefineLoadsApplyStructuralDisplacementOnKeypoints选择关键点1,选择AllDOF,点击OK7、分析计算MainmenuSolutionSolveCurrentLS点击OK8、结果的一般显示1)对线单元按实体效果进行显示UtilityMenuPlotCtrlsStyleSizeandShapeESHAPEON在SCALE输入0.5,点击OK2)显示完整的有限元模型,UtilityMenuPlotCtrlsStyleSymmetryExpansionPeriodic/CycleSymmetryExpansion选择ReflectaboutYZ点击OK效果如图所示:3)吉林大学机械科学与工程学院41121010林亮基第3页4)对计算结果进行云图显示,这里用的是X-ComponentofDisplacement,如下图所示:轴力图和剪力图如下:吉林大学机械科学与工程学院41121010林亮基第4页实验2:基于APDL命令流方式的杆系结构有限元静力学分析一、问题描述一座小型铁路桥由横截面积均为3250mm2的钢制杆件组成。一辆货车停在桥上,其载荷施加在桥梁两侧的桁架上,单侧桁架如上图所示,等效载荷为F1和F2,材料弹性模量为E=2.1×105MPa,泊松比为0.3,密度为7.8×105kg/m3。使计算位置R处由载荷作用而沿着水平方向移动的距离以及支反力。同时,分析各节点的位移和单元应力二、实验思路由于并不熟悉命令流操作,所以我先按照实验指导上的操作步骤完成了有限元分析,再查看命令流文件,并且把命令流复制移植了一次,试验其是否能达到效果。三、实验步骤由于GUI操作的步骤在其他实验中已经尝试,故在此不再重复赘述,直接展示分析结果图:变形图如下:位移云图如下:吉林大学机械科学与工程学院41121010林亮基第5页轴力图如下:吉林大学机械科学与工程学院41121010林亮基第6页实验3:实体建模一、实验目的:通过本实验熟悉ANSYS界面、空间、基本建模操作、布尔运算。二、实验模型图三、实验思路按照实验指导书的指导,先建立长方体、圆柱等基本图形,再进行布尔运算减去多余部分,而且考虑到模型是对称结构,所以先建一半的模型,然后通过镜像获得整个模型。四、实验步骤1、创建模型Step1生成长方体MainMenu:PreprocessorCreateBlockByDimensions在对话框中输入X1=0,X2=3,Y1=1,Y2=1,Z1=0,Z2=3Step2平移并旋转工作平面UtilityMenuWorkPlaneOffsetWPbyIncrements把工作平面的坐标原点移动到(2.25,1.25,0.75),并旋转90°Step3创建圆柱体MainMenu:PreprocessorCreateCylinderSolidCylinder创建一个半径为0.375,、高度为-1.5的圆柱体再通过Copy菜单复制一个圆柱体Step4利用布尔操作减去圆柱体MainMenu:PreprocessorModelingOperateBooleanSubtractVolume操作完成后将工作坐标移动到原始坐标Step5创建支撑部分(长方体)MainMenu:PreprocessorCreateBlockBy2corners&Z吉林大学机械科学与工程学院41121010林亮基第7页长方体的尺寸为1.5*1.75*0.75完成操作后将工作坐标原点偏移到刚创建的长方体的左上角。在平面视图拾取点可能会拾取不正确,转换为立体视图拾取就一目了然了。Step6创建轴瓦支架的上部MainMenu:PreprocessorModelingCreateCylinderPartialCylinderStep7在轴承孔的位置创建圆柱体为布尔操作做准备MainMenu:PreprocessorModelingCreateCylinderSolidCylinderStep8用布尔操作减去两个圆柱体,生成轴承孔执行MainMenu:PreprocessorModelingOperateBooleanSubtractVolumeStep9合并重合的关键点Step10创建一个关键点,并利用该点与另外两点生成一个三角形平面这一步需要用到CreateKeypoints、CreateArea等操作Step11将三角形平面拉伸成实体MainMenu:PreprocessorModelingOperateExtrudeStep12通过镜像操作生成完整模型MainMenu:PreprocessorModelingReflect效果如图所示(通过Numbering开启了体的标号,颜色效果比较好看)2、定义单元类型和材料属性Step1定义单元类型执行MainMenuPreprocessorElementTypeAdd/Edit/Delete在14.0版本中,选择的是SolidTet10node187单元。熟悉了14.0的单元种类之后,要找到合适的类型替代指导书给出的单元也没以前那么难了。Step2定义材料属性为了定义材料的属性,在ANSYS界面中执行MainMenuPreprocessorMaterialPropsMaterialModelsStructuralLinearElasticIsotropic弹性模量输入30e6,泊松比输入0.3。指导书没有给出泊松比,在老师的指导下选用了0.3吉林大学机械科学与工程学院41121010林亮基第8页3、划分网格打开meshingtool,将智能网格划分器设置为on,将滑动条滑到“6”,指导书给出的是“8”,但为了获得更好的效果,以及出于对电脑运算速度的信心,我设置为6,后来发现网格其实还是比较大的。确认各项为Vol